#b18ed0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b18ed0 is composed of 69.4% red, 55.7%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.9% cyan, 31.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 271.8 degrees, a saturation of 41.3% and a lightness of 68.6%. #b18ed0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#631da1.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

● #b18ed0 color description : Slightly desaturated violet.
#b18ed0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b18ed0 has RGB values of R:177, G:142,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0.32,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 11636432.

Shades and Tints of #b18ed0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08050c is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b18ed0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#afadb1 is the less saturated color, while #b463fb is the most saturated one.
